Multiparametric Imaging in Cancer Research: Technical Approaches and Applications


Published September 9, 2024

On September 13, 2024, Euro-BioImaging hosts the Cancer Metabolism Series in collaboration with the International Society of Cancer Metabolism (ISCaM). This series of lectures takes place once a month during the Virtual Pub, bringing together speakers from the cancer metabolism field with imaging experts from the Euro-BioImaging network, for exchange with enthusiasts from the biological & biomedical imaging fields in the Virtual Pub audience. Our speakers on Friday, September 13 are Anna Tosi and Serena Zilio, Veneto Institute of Oncology, IOV-IRCCS, on "Multiparametric Imaging in Cancer Research: Technical Approaches and Applications."

Abstract

Multiparametric imaging techniques have revolutionized our ability to study the complex interactions within the tumor microenvironment, particularly in the fields of immunology. This seminar will examine advanced staining methodologies that employ multiple antibodies to simultaneously visualize immune cell phenotypes and tumor heterogeneity. The objective is to gain insight into the intricate cell interactions that occur within the tumor microenvironment. This presentation aims to elucidate the benefits of these high-dimensional techniques, including enhanced spatial resolution and deeper insights into cellular dynamics, while also addressing the challenges posed by data complexity and technical optimization. Finally, the discussion will focus on the critical role of bioinformatics in analyzing these large datasets and how the integration of multiparametric imaging with in situ transcriptomics, offers a promising frontier for advancing cancer research. Together, these approaches pave the way for a more comprehensive understanding of tumor biology, potentially leading to novel therapeutic strategies.
